The Emergence of Theileria parva in Jonglei State, South Sudan: Confirmation Using Molecular and Serological Diagnostic Tools

Abstract: A cross-sectional survey was carried out in four counties of Jonglei State, South Sudan, between May and June 2012 to determine the distribution and northern limit of Theileria parva, the causative agent of East Coast fever in cattle, and its tick vector Rhipicephalus appendiculatus, as a prerequisite to the deployment of relevant control strategies. A total of 1636 ticks, 386 serum samples and 399 blood samples were collected from indigenous, apparently healthy, cattle of different age groups. Tick species we… Show more

“…Among 100 Ankole cattle from farms directly adjacent to LMNP, 56% were positive by p104 PCR. Further north in the Sudan, T. parva has been observed to be endemic in cattle, and the presence of the parasite and the vector in this country is thought to be at least partially mediated by extensive anthropogenic movement of livestock (Malak et al 2012;Marcellino et al 2015;Salih et al 2007). In this context, it will be important to examine the T. parva infection status of cape buffalo in South Sudan, since ITM vaccination may in future be deployed in this region, and it is possible that buffalo-derived T. parva could breakthrough immunity induced in cattle as observed in Kenya.…”

“…Theileria parva causes East Coast fever (ECF), an economically important disease of cattle in 15 countries in eastern, southern and central Africa where it is the major source of cattle mortality in the low resource livestock agroecosytems (Thumbi et al., ). There are recent reports of geographical spread of T. parva at the borders of the existing distribution and over substantial geographical distances (Marcellino et al., , Silatsa et al. in this issue).…”

“…Extensive anthropogenically mediated movement of cattle is known to occur between Northern Uganda and South Sudan and, as a consequence, both R. appendiculatus and T. parva have been detected over extensive regions of South Sudan ( Salih et al ., 2018 ;Marcellino et al ., 2012Marcellino et al ., , 2017. As a result, East Coast fever is an emerging problem in that country and the long-term impact may be considerable.…”
